Abstract

The utility model discloses a water level monitoring device, which comprises a base, wherein threaded through holes are oppositely arranged in the base, an L-shaped rod is fixedly connected to the upper end of the base, a measuring rod is arranged at one end of the L-shaped rod, a cavity is arranged in the measuring rod, a sliding block is slidably arranged in the cavity, a long rope penetrating through the bottom of the measuring rod is arranged at the lower end of the sliding block, a straight rod is arranged at one side of the measuring rod, a guide wheel matched with the long rope is rotatably arranged at one end of the straight rod, a buoyancy ball is arranged at one end of the long rope, a guide plate is arranged at one side of the sliding block, a guide groove matched with the guide plate is arranged at one side of the cavity in the measuring rod, an infrared ranging sensor matched with the guide plate is arranged at the top of the guide groove, and an alarm button matched with the guide plate is arranged at the bottom of the guide groove. Compared with the prior art, the utility model has the advantages that: monitoring data can be remotely sent to the staff and an alarm can be raised when the water level exceeds the warning line.

Description

Water level monitoring device
Technical Field
The utility model relates to the technical field of water level monitoring, in particular to a water level monitoring device.
Background
The water level monitoring is a hydrologic monitoring, and the observation multipurpose water level of water level is provided, and the water level is in the aquatic after long-time soaking, and the surface of water level is attached to mud and moss easily, can influence the reading, and current water level monitoring devices also can not long-range data to staff send, can not send the alarm when the water level surpasses the warning line moreover.
Disclosure of Invention
The technical problem to be solved by the utility model is to overcome the technical defects, and provide the water level monitoring device which can remotely send monitoring data to staff and send an alarm when the water level exceeds a warning line.

As an improvement, the upper end of the L-shaped rod is provided with a warning lamp electrically connected with the control module, so that the warning effect of giving out an alarm can be improved.
As an improvement, a sealing ring matched with the long rope is arranged at the bottom of the measuring rod.
As an improvement, one side of the measuring rod is provided with a fixed plate, and the lower end of the fixed plate is provided with a guide rod penetrating through the buoyancy ball, so that a guiding effect can be provided for the buoyancy ball, and the accuracy of water level monitoring can be improved.
As an improvement, the surface of the sliding block and the inner wall of the cavity are made of smooth materials, so that the friction force between the sliding block and the cavity can be reduced.
As an improvement, the threaded through hole is connected with the ground by using an expansion bolt.

When the wireless alarm device is used, the base is installed on the ground beside water, the base is placed on the ground, the threaded through holes are aligned to punch holes in the ground, then the expansion pipe is placed in the hole, the expansion pipe is connected with the threaded through holes through bolts, the base can be fixed on the ground, the measuring rod is inserted into water at the moment, in the use process, the buoyancy ball drives the sliding block to slide in the cavity along with the change of the height of the water level through the long rope, the guide plate moves along with the sliding block, the infrared ranging sensor can monitor the distance between the guide plate and the infrared ranging sensor in real time and transmit data to the wireless data transmission module, the wireless data transmission module can remotely transmit the processed data to a worker through the antenna, when the water level is too high, the guide plate moves downwards until an alarm button is pressed, the buzzer sounds, the alarm lamp flashes, and the wireless data transmission module can send the information of the too high water level to the worker through the antenna, so that an alarm can be sent when the water level exceeds the line.
